Biography

Prior to pursuing her career as a nurse, and later as a family nurse practitioner, Lakshmi was a pharmacist in India. As a child, she always wanted to work in healthcare to make a positive impact and meaningfully contribute to the welfare of society. This desire steered her toward nursing, and to later become a nurse practitioner, so that she could have a greater impact and develop a closer relationship with patients. For two years, Lakshmi worked as a nurse in both cardiovascular and women’s surgical units. Since 2020, she has served as a family nurse practitioner in rural towns of South Texas. Lakshmi believes in a holistic approach to patient care, treating patients the way she or her family would like to be treated. In addition to treating physical ailments with targeted approaches and medication, she also believes that “mind over matter” plays a large role, and that strong affirmations with healthy lifestyle changes can greatly contribute to controlling many health conditions. Seeing her patients improve or completely overcome their medical conditions gives Lakshmi immense happiness and satisfaction, and motivates her to go to work every day.
